D. Stallworth to Browns, B. Berrian to Vikings
Randy Moss remains unsigned but other wide receivers, including former New England Patriots teammate Donte' Stallworth, are finding teams.
Stallworth has agreed to a deal with the Cleveland Browns. The Patriots made him a free agent by declining to pick up an option in his contract.
Wideout Bernard Berrian, an unrestricted free agent, reached a contract agreement with the Minnesota Vikings. He had 71 catches for 951 yards and five touchdowns for the Bears this past season and was rated the second-best receiver available on the unrestricted free agent market, behind Moss, by many observers.
